Pytania otagowane jako regex

Regex (lub regexp) jest znane jako dopasowywanie wyrażeń regularnych wzorców, ciągów lub znaków, na przykład w dużym pliku tekstowym. Pytania powinny być oznaczone jako takie, niezależnie od używanego języka programowania, a znacznik może również odnosić się do programów wiersza poleceń lub programów graficznych, które mają wtyczki regex lub pewne możliwości regex.

7
Wydrukuj słowo zawierające ciąg i pierwsze słowo
Chcę znaleźć ciąg w wierszu tekstu i wydrukować ciąg (między spacjami) i pierwsze słowo frazy. Na przykład: „To jest pojedyncza linia tekstu” "Inna rzecz" „Lepiej spróbuj ponownie” "Lepszy" Lista ciągów to: tekst rzecz próbować Lepszy Próbuję uzyskać taki stół: Ten [tab] tekst Kolejna rzecz [tab] To [tab] próbuje Lepszy Próbowałem …

2
Pytania dotyczące używania Regex Search & Replace w gedit
Próbuję użyć wtyczki Regex Search & Replace programu gedit. Chcę wyszukać cyfrę, która powtarza się 2 lub 3 razy, więc pomyślałem, że regex był [0-9]\{2,3\} Ale nie pasuje do celów, które powinien, takich jak „22”. Chcę znaleźć dokładnie słowo „Notatki”, więc pomyślałem, że tak będzie \<Notes\> Ale to też nie …
10 python  gedit  regex 




1
Grep -E, Sed -E - niska wydajność przy użyciu „[x] {1,9999}”, ale dlaczego?
Gdy greplub sedsą używane z opcją, --extended-regexpa wzorzec {1,9999}jest częścią używanego wyrażenia regularnego, wydajność tych poleceń staje się niska. Aby być bardziej zrozumiałym, poniżej zastosowano kilka testów. [1] [2] Względna wydajność grep -E, egrepi sed -Ejest prawie równa, więc tylko testy, które zostały wykonane z grep -Esą świadczone. Test 1 …

7
Jedna linijka ffmpeg (lub inna), aby uzyskać tylko rozdzielczość?
Nie jestem zbyt dobrze zorientowany w linii poleceń, więc mam nadzieję, że nie jest to zbyt głupie pytanie. Jeśli uruchomię: ffmpeg -i videofile.avi Otrzymuję dane wyjściowe takie jak to: ffmpeg version git-2013-11-21-6a7980e Copyright (c) 2000-2013 the FFmpeg develop ers built on Nov 21 2013 12:06:32 with gcc 4.6 (Ubuntu/Linaro 4.6.3-1ubuntu5) …
9 bash  ffmpeg  regex  pipe 

1
Krótszy sposób na apt-get install php7.0- {niektóre moduły}
Obecnie instaluję php7.0 i zastanawiałem się, czy istnieje krótszy sposób instalacji modułów. zwykle piszę: apt-get install php7.0 php7.0-fpm php7.0-mbstring php7.0-mcrypt php7.0-phpdbg php7.0-dev php7.0-curl php7.0-sqlite3 php7.0-json php7.0-gd php7.0-cli Czy istnieje wyrażenie regularne, więc nie musisz ciągle pisać php7.0? Coś jak: apt-get install php7.0-{fpm mbstring mcrypt phpdbg dev curl sqlite3 json gd …
8 apt  bash  regex  php7 

2
Wstawianie zmiennej do komendy sed w skrypcie bash
Mam plik tekstowy podobny do tego: Some-text Keyword Some-text Some-text Keyword Some-text Keyword Keyword Chcę zastąpić każde „Słowo kluczowe” ciągiem „liczba.rozszerzenie”, gdzie liczba to 1 przy pierwszym dopasowaniu słowa kluczowego, 2 przy drugim dopasowaniu słowa kluczowego itp. Wiem, że powinienem używać pętli bash w połączeniu z sed (sed: słowo kluczowe: …
bash  sed  regex 
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.